Doha Airport: Free, Fast, And Reliable Wi-Fi For Travelers

is there wifi at doha airport

Hamad International Airport in Doha, Qatar, offers free high-speed Wi-Fi throughout the airport. To connect, passengers can simply select the #HIAQatar network on their device and enjoy up to 4 hours of uninterrupted connection. No password or SMS verification is required. Additionally, the airport provides internet kiosks and desks equipped with screens and keyboards for free web browsing. These are located throughout the passenger terminal, including boarding gate areas. While some travellers have reported variable speeds, others have found the Wi-Fi suitable for streaming and downloading. Qatar Airways has also invested in Starlink Wi-Fi for its 777s and A350s, providing fast and reliable inflight connectivity.

Qatar Airways has been rolling out Starlink Wi-Fi on its Boeing 777s, with the first Starlink-equipped flight taking place on 22 October 2024. The airline has installed Starlink on over 80% of its 777s, and the project is expected to be complete in the coming weeks. The service is offered complimentary to passengers, with one-click access to high-speed, low-latency internet. This allows passengers to stream content, play games, and upload and download files as they would on the ground.

Starlink is engineered and operated by SpaceX and is the world's first and largest satellite constellation using a low Earth orbit. It provides reliable, high-speed internet access, allowing passengers to stay connected with friends and family, stream entertainment, watch live sports, play online games, or work efficiently during their flight.

In addition to the Boeing 777s, Qatar Airways also plans to install Starlink on its Airbus A350s, with the first A350 expected to receive the service in April 2025. Doha Airport has internet kiosks and desks with free web browsing

Hamad International Airport in Doha offers free wireless internet access throughout the passenger terminal. To connect to the Wi-Fi, passengers can simply search for “#HIAQatar” on their devices and connect for up to 4-hour intervals without the need for a password or SMS/email verification. This service is especially useful for solo travellers who may need access to the internet during long layovers.

In addition to Wi-Fi, Hamad International Airport also provides internet kiosks and desks with free web browsing. These kiosks and desks are equipped with screens and keyboards and can be found throughout the passenger terminal, including the boarding gate areas and the five activity nodes inside the terminal. The activity nodes, which offer internet browsing alongside televisions, toys, mini-rides, and climbing frames, are located in Concourse A, Concourse B, and three in Concourse C.

For those who prefer not to rely on airport Wi-Fi, there is the option to purchase a "travel pass" from certain phone providers, which offers coverage in 185 countries, including Qatar. Alternatively, passengers can opt to pay for access to a lounge, which typically provides reliable internet service, as well as food and drinks.
